The principal advantages of a DBMS are the followings:
• Flexibility: Because programs and data are independent, programs do not have to be modified when types of unrelated data are added to or deleted from the database, or when physical storage changes.
• Fast response to information requests: Because data are integrated into a single database, complex requests can be handled much more rapidly then if the data were located in separate, non-integrated files. In many businesses, faster response means better customer service.
• Multiple access: Database software allows data to be accessed in a variety of ways (such as through various key fields) and often, by using several programming languages (both 3GL and nonprocedural 4GL programs).
• Lower user training costs: Users often find it easier to learn such systems and training costs may be reduced. Also, the total time taken to process requests may be shorter, which would increase user productivity.

In File System, files are used to store data while, collections of databases are utilized for the storage of data in DBMS. Although File System and DBMS are two ways of managing data, DBMS clearly has many advantages over File Systems. Typically when using a File System, most tasks such as storage, retrieval and search are done manually and it is quite tedious whereas a DBMS will provide automated methods to complete these tasks. Because of this reason, using a File System will lead to problems like data integrity, data inconsistency and data security, but these problems could be avoided by using a DBMS. Unlike File System, DBMS are efficient because reading line by line is not required and certain control mechanisms are in place.

A flat file is a simple file containing data without any structured format, while a Database Management System (DBMS) is a software system that manages databases by organizing, storing, and retrieving data. A DBMS allows for more organized and efficient data management, supports relationships between data, and provides features like security and data integrity that are not available with flat files.

File based approach can be attributed to two factors: 1. the definition of the data is embedded in the application programs, rather than being stored separately and independently. 2. there is no control over the access and manipulation of data beyond that imposed by the application programs. To become more effective, a new approach was required. What emerged were the database and the DBMS (Database management system).
